What is CVE-2026-21361?

Adobe Commerce contains a st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in various versions, enabling high-privileged attackers to inject malicious scripts into vulnerable form fields. This vulnerability can lead to the execution of harmful JavaScript in a victim’s browser when they navigate to the affected page. Exploiting this flaw necessitates user interaction as victims must visit the page hosting the compromised field, allowing an attacker to potentially hijack sessions and compromise user confidentiality.
